编程四级考什么内容好一点

fiy 其他 21

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程四级考试主要涵盖以下内容:

    1. 编程基础知识:包括数据类型、变量、运算符、控制流程等基础概念和语法规则。

    2. 数据结构与算法:包括数组、链表、栈、队列、树、图等基本数据结构和常用算法,如排序、查找、递归等。

    3. 面向对象编程:包括类、对象、继承、多态、封装等面向对象的概念和相关语法。

    4. 数据库基础:包括数据库的概念、SQL语言的基本操作、数据库设计与规范等。

    5. 网络编程:包括网络协议、Socket编程、HTTP协议、Web开发等相关知识。

    6. 系统设计与架构:包括系统设计原则、模块化、分层架构、设计模式等。

    7. 软件工程与项目管理:包括软件开发过程、需求分析、项目管理、版本控制等相关知识。

    8. 前沿技术与应用:包括人工智能、大数据、云计算、物联网等前沿技术及其应用。

    在备考过程中,建议重点关注编程基础知识、数据结构与算法以及面向对象编程等核心内容,同时了解数据库基础、网络编程和系统设计等相关知识。通过多做练习题、参加实践项目以及阅读相关书籍和文章,可以帮助加深理解和掌握这些知识点。另外,保持良好的学习习惯和持续学习的态度也非常重要。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程四级考试主要涵盖以下内容:

    1. 编程基础知识:这是编程四级考试的基础,包括编程语言的基本概念、语法规则、数据类型、变量、运算符等。考生需要熟悉常用的编程语言,如C、C++、Java等,并掌握基本的编程思维和解决问题的能力。

    2. 算法与数据结构:算法与数据结构是编程四级考试的重点,考察考生对常见算法和数据结构的理解和运用。常见的算法包括排序、查找、递归等,常见的数据结构包括数组、链表、栈、队列、树等。考生需要熟悉这些算法和数据结构的原理和实现方式,并能够根据具体问题选择合适的算法和数据结构。

    3. 网络编程:随着互联网的发展,网络编程在编程四级考试中的重要性也越来越高。考生需要了解网络通信的基本原理,掌握常用的网络编程技术,如Socket编程、HTTP协议、TCP/IP协议等。此外,考生还需要了解网络安全的基本知识,如加密、身份验证等。

    4. 数据库:数据库是现代软件开发中不可或缺的一部分。在编程四级考试中,考生需要了解数据库的基本概念和原理,掌握SQL语言的基本操作,如数据查询、插入、更新、删除等。此外,考生还需要了解常见的数据库管理系统,如MySQL、Oracle等。

    5. 软件工程:软件工程是编程四级考试中的一项重要内容,考察考生对软件开发过程的理解和掌握。包括需求分析、系统设计、编码、测试、部署等各个阶段的知识。考生需要了解常用的软件开发方法和流程,如敏捷开发、水fall模型等,以及常用的开发工具和技术,如版本控制、集成开发环境等。

    以上是编程四级考试的主要内容,考生可以根据这些内容进行备考,提高自己的编程水平。同时,还需要注重实际操作和实践,通过编程项目的实践来提升自己的编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程四级考试主要考察学生在编程语言基础、算法与数据结构、程序设计方法等方面的知识和能力。下面是一些可以提高编程四级考试成绩的学习内容和方法:

    1. 编程语言基础:

      • 熟练掌握一门主流编程语言,如C、C++、Java等,并了解其语法、基本数据类型、运算符等。
      • 熟悉常用的编程语言特性,如条件语句、循环语句、函数、数组、指针等。
      • 学习掌握编程语言的高级特性,如面向对象编程、异常处理、泛型等。
    2. 算法与数据结构:

      • 学习基本的数据结构,如数组、链表、栈、队列、树等,并了解它们的特点和应用场景。
      • 理解常见的算法思想,如递归、分治、动态规划、贪心等,并能应用到具体的问题中。
      • 熟悉常见的排序算法,如冒泡排序、选择排序、插入排序、快速排序、归并排序等,并了解它们的时间复杂度和空间复杂度。
    3. 程序设计方法:

      • 学习软件工程的基本概念和原理,如模块化、抽象、封装、继承、多态等。
      • 掌握面向对象的程序设计方法,能够设计类和对象,并实现封装、继承和多态等特性。
      • 学会使用常见的设计模式,如单例模式、工厂模式、观察者模式等,提高程序的可扩展性和可维护性。
    4. 实践和项目经验:

      • 多做编程练习题,加深对知识点的理解和应用能力。
      • 参与开源项目或自己进行小项目的开发,提高编程能力和实践经验。
      • 学会使用调试工具,能够定位和解决程序中的错误和问题。
    5. 多做模拟考试:

      • 考试前进行模拟考试,熟悉考试的题型和时间限制,提高应试能力。
      • 对模拟考试的结果进行分析和总结,找出自己的薄弱环节,并针对性地进行复习。

    总之,编程四级考试需要全面掌握编程语言基础、算法与数据结构、程序设计方法等知识,同时注重实践和项目经验的积累。通过系统的学习和练习,加上模拟考试的训练,可以提高编程四级考试的成绩。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部